The Career Advancement Programme in Additive Manufacturing for Toy Customization is a certificate course designed to empower learners with essential skills in additive manufacturing, also known as 3D printing. This program is crucial in today's industry, where personalization and customization are key drivers of growth and innovation.

With a growing demand for additive manufacturing specialists, this course provides learners with the necessary skills to meet industry needs. It covers various aspects of additive manufacturing, including design, production, post-processing, and quality control, with a focus on toy customization. Upon completion, learners will be equipped with the skills to design and produce customized toys, giving them a competitive edge in the job market. This course not only enhances learners' technical skills but also their creativity, problem-solving abilities, and entrepreneurial mindset. By enrolling in this program, learners can take a significant step towards career advancement in additive manufacturing.

Introduction to Additive Manufacturing: Overview of AM technologies, history, and its impact on modern manufacturing
3D Modeling for Toy Customization: Basics of 3D modeling, design software, and creating custom toys
Materials in Additive Manufacturing: Understanding materials used in AM, their properties, and applications
Principles of Additive Manufacturing: Deep dive into the principles, processes, and techniques of AM
Additive Manufacturing Technologies: Exploring FDM, SLA, SLS, and other AM technologies
Post-processing Techniques: Cleaning, finishing, and improving 3D printed toys for better aesthetics
Quality Control in Additive Manufacturing: Ensuring product quality, consistency, and safety
Sustainability in Additive Manufacturing: Examining the environmental impact and sustainability of AM
Case Studies: Additive Manufacturing in Toy Industry: Real-world examples of successful AM toy customization projects
Career Pathways in Additive Manufacturing: Exploring job opportunities, career growth, and skills required for success in AM

In the ever-evolving world of additive manufacturing (AM), staying updated with job market trends and skill demands is crucial. This Career Advancement Programme in Additive Manufacturing for Toy Customization focuses on roles that showcase the potential of this cutting-edge technology in the toy industry. Let's explore the opportunities and statistics in this fascinating field. 1. 3D Printing Engineer: With a 45% share, 3D Printing Engineers lead the pack in AM career opportunities. They're responsible for designing, testing, and implementing 3D printing solutions, ensuring seamless integration with toy customization processes. 2. Additive Manufacturing Specialist: In demand with a 30% share, Additive Manufacturing Specialists focus on creating and optimizing digital designs for 3D printing. Their expertise in AM technologies and processes helps streamline toy customization and production. 3. Toy Designer (with AM skills): A niche yet essential role, Toy Designers with AM skills hold a 20% share in this industry. They combine traditional design techniques with AM technology to create innovative, customizable, and safe toy designs. 4. CAD/CAM Specialist: Rounding out the list with a 5% share, CAD/CAM Specialists convert 3D models into machine-readable files, which is essential for 3D printing in toy customization. By understanding the job market trends and skill demands in additive manufacturing for toy customization, professionals can make informed decisions about their career paths and embrace the opportunities presented by this exciting technology.
